Abstract:
Embodiments of the present disclosure relate to methods and apparatuses for channel estimation and feedback in a three dimensional multiple input multiple output (3D-MIMO) system. A method may comprise: transmitting a plurality of reference signals for a plurality of columns in an antenna array; receiving indication information on configuration adjustment of a precoding information feedback, wherein the indication information is based on measurement on the plurality of reference signals; and adjusting a configuration of the precoding information feedback based on the indication information so that a multiple vertical precoding information feedback is enabled when it can obtain a performance gain. Especially, the multiple vertical precoding information feedback may represent feeding back a plurality of vertical precoding matrix indicators for the plurality of columns in the antenna array. In embodiments of the present disclosure, there is provided a new solution for channel estimation and feedback in a 3D-MIMO system, and it may achieve a more accurate beamforming and/or a higher order spatial multiplexing, thereby improving the performance of the 3D-MIMO system.
